Swimming at the 1971 Pan American Games – Women's 100 metre backstroke
The women's 100 metre backstroke competition of the swimming events at the 1971 Pan American Games took place on 7 August.[1][2] The last Pan American Games champion was Elaine Tanner of Canada.[3][4][5][6][7][8]

This race consisted of two lengths of the pool, all in backstroke.[9]

Final
The final was held on August 7.[1]
Rank | Name | Nationality | Time | Notes |
---|---|---|---|---|
![]() | Donna Gurr | ![]() | 1:07.2 | GR |
![]() | Susie Atwood | ![]() | 1:07.5 | |
![]() | Jill Hlay | ![]() | 1:08.5 | |
4 | Leslie Cliff | ![]() | 1:09.5 | |
5 | Maria Teresa Ramírez | ![]() | 1:11.1 | NR |
6 | Adriana Grehnikoff | ![]() | 1:13.3 | |
7 | Liana Vicens | ![]() | 1:15.0 | |
8 | Lucila Martins | ![]() | 1:15.1 |
